Distance From Baiyun Airport to Antananarivo Airport (CAN - TNR Distance)

The flight distance from Baiyun Airport (CAN) to Antananarivo Airport (TNR) is 5308 miles. This is equivalent to 8542 kilometers or 4610 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.


8542 kilometers is the distance from Baiyun Airport, China to Antananarivo Airport, Madagascar.


Flight Duration between Guangzhou, China and Antananarivo, Madagascar

Estimated flight time from Baiyun Airport, Guangzhou, China to Antananarivo Airport, Antananarivo, Madagascar is 10 hours 37 minutes under avarage conditions. The flight time calculator assumes an average flight speed for a commercial airliner of 500 mph, which is equivalent to 805 km/hr or 434 knots. Your actual flying time may vary depending on wind speeds or weather conditions.
